INTRODUCTION The Warrior, the revolutionary patent pending PA.710A is a 2G/3G/4G, High Efficiency SMT Ceramic antenna, operating at 698MHz to 960MHz and 1710MHz to 2690MHz. It uses high grade custom ceramic material and new design techniques to deliver the highest efficiencies on all bands when mounted on the device’s main PCB. The exceptional wide-band response means it is the ideal antenna for all LTE applications that also need high efficiency and backward compatibility for 2G and 3G globally on all lower and upper bands. The PA.710A is delivered on tape and reel and mounted securely during the device PCB reflow process. 1.1 Key Advantages 1. Highest efficiency in a small size, i.e. 40mm*6mm*5mm. A comparative antenna, for example metal/FR4/FPC/whip/rod/helix, would have much reduced efficiency in this configuration due to their different dielectric constants. Very high efficiency antennas are critical to 3G and 4G devices ability to deliver the stated data-speed rates of systems such as HSPA and LTE. 2. More resistant to detuning compared to other antenna integrations. If tuning is required it can be tuned for the device environment using a matching circuit, or other techniques on the main PCB itself. There is no need for new tooling, thereby saving money if customization is required. 3. Highly reliable and robust– its predecessors the PA.25A and PA700A antennas are used by the world’s leading automotive makers in extremely challenging environments. The antenna meets all temperature and mechanical specs required (vibration, drop tests etc) 4. Easy to integrate. Other antenna designs come in irregular shapes and sizes making them more difficult to integrate. 5. Surface Mount Technology (Directly On-Board) antenna saves on labor, cable and connector costs, leads to higher integration yield rates, and reduces losses in transmission. 6. Minimum Transmission and Reception Losses - these are kept to absolute minimum resulting in much improved OTA (over the air), i.e. TRP (Total Radiated Power)/TIS (Total Isotropic Radiation), device performance compared to similar efficiency cable and connector antenna solutions. This means it is an ideal antenna to be used for devices that need to pass for example USA carrier network approvals 7. RSE Reductions – will help to eliminate radiated spurious emission failures compared to other antenna technologies as the required layout for the antenna can deliver natural isolation between the onboard noise and the antenna itself. Also the antenna can be matched better to the system with the matching circuit function. |
